GLUED EYES: A love and hate life through the eye of a camera

I’ve always seen photography as the art form closest to our hearts. It captures our purest emotions, and every click reflects the countless feelings and phases we go through in life.

In this series, I explore the idea of being Lost—lost in a world where we cling to illusions of love and friendship. At times, even the strongest and most rational person may lose sight along their journey.

With this concept in mind, and with the help of my two friends Nev and Sean, a couple, I recreated my feelings, thoughts, and reflections through this series. Like in many relationships, when you look into Nev’s eyes, you may see hatred, sickness, and disgust toward Sean. Yet through her body language, she clings to him like glue, deeply reliant on his presence. Conversely, though Sean’s face and eyes are often hidden, his body language conveys care and love.

As viewers, I invite you to explore the subtle interplay between their eyes and movements. Is it happiness? Is it what we call a red flag? Or is it merely an illusion born from our imagination?
